This little droid is a Christmas present for my friend Rhonda, AKA Rhonda2D2. Ever sinceĀ Star Wars: Uncut, Artoo has made me think of her, so I hope she gets a kick out of it.
It’s funny how the different colors mold differently. The white clay was much softer and more pliable—to the point where it was impossible to get my fingerprints out of it—than, say, the black, which crumbled in my hands no matter how much I kneaded it first.
This is the first sculpture I’ve baked since the puppet heads from the film shoot, so I was a little worried it would crack, but it came out beautifully. Working in color is much more time consuming, but the finished product looks so much nicer, wouldn’t you say?
Sculpey III (white, black, and denim), ~3 hours
